    Abstract: Methods of producing ready-to-eat pasta that has improved taste, texture, and color are disclosed. The methods include blanching pasta in acidified water, draining, cooling, and packaging the pasta, and thermally processing the packaged pasta. Also disclosed are products containing ready-to-eat pasta sealed in a container, wherein the pasta has a pH above about 4.5, and wherein the container is substantially free of added liquid.

    Abstract: Chemical flashings for track assemblies and mount assemblies employed in solar power installations are disclosed. In some embodiments, a track assembly having a base, a pair of rails, a sealant receiving cavity and a round groove extending into the base from the bottom of the base, and a compressible round seal disposed within the base extending past the bottom is disclosed. In some embodiments, a mount assembly having a vertical structure, a sealant receiving cavity and a round groove extending into the base from the bottom of the base, a compressible round seal disposed within the base extending past the bottom, and an excess sealant cavity is disclosed.

    Abstract: A v-clamp is used to join tubular bodies having end flanges in order to form a joint therebetween. Such tubular bodies are employed in heavy-duty and moderate and light-duty applications including, but not limited to, industrial, oil and gas, sewage, agriculture, and automotive applications. The v-clamp can include a band, a closure mechanism, and a set of bearings. The v-clamp may furnish a more evenly and uniformly distributed clamping force around a circumference of the v-clamp and to the tubular body end flanges than previously demonstrated.

    Abstract: A method includes generating movement signals indicative of sensed movement of a powered system in one or more directions and generating fluid level signals indicative of a sensed amount of fluid in the powered system. The method also includes, with one or more processors, receiving the movement signals and the fluid level signals from one or more accelerometers and a fluid level sensor, wherein the one or more processors also configured to filter at least some of the movement signals based on a speed at which the powered system operates. The method also includes, with a first antenna of the sensor assembly, wirelessly communicating one or more of the movement signals or the amount of fluid to a remote location.
